Wedding auction to raise vital funds for charity

SHARE

Calling all engaged couples in the Hunter, do you want the money you spend on your wedding to go to a good cause?

If the answer is yes, then you need to make a bid for The 2 Montys Charity Wedding Event. 

On Sunday 30 January an $80,000 wedding package will be auctioned off to the highest bidder. 

It includes everything you need to get hitched on Friday 24 June 2022 at Enzo Hunter Valley’s Ironbark Hill Vineyard.

It’s a date celebrants and charity auction organisers Monty King and Monty Haron were lucky to score given the number of weddings that have been rescheduled after COVID-19 forced couples to press pause on their nuptials. 

All funds will be donated to RUN DIPG, a local charity that’s dedicated to helping children impacted by the deadliest form of cancer – diffuse intrinsic pontine glioma (DIPG).

Coordinated by Dr Matt Dun – a renowned cancer researcher at the Hunter Medical Research Institute (HMRI) and the University of Newcastle – RUN DIPG has funded critical medical research into the illness. 

Dr Dun started the charity after losing his daughter Josephine, who passed away with DIPG at just four years old in 2019. 

Monty King said they chose the charity to help it continue its vital work. 

“We decided it was their turn this time,” he said. 

“We’ve previously raised funds for Camp Quality and The Starlight Foundation. 

“We like to keep the charity local, [and] from a personal perspective there is a little girl my son knows who had DIPG so I wanted to help the charity that supports children with this cancer.” 

The auction will be hosted at Enzo Hunter Valley and online. 

At the previous two events, they raised $34,500 for Camp Quality and $40,100 for The Starlight Foundation – they’re hoping to beat that number again this year. 

How their partnership came about was easy, the celebrants thought it was unique that they were both named Monty. 

“I got wind of another fella called Monty becoming a marriage celebrant and I thought it was uncanny that we had the same name,” Mr King said. 

“We became friends and we talked about doing a wedding together and that evolved into doing it for charity and it went from there.”
